Advancement of Web Design

Over time I think that websites will increase in size. This is because the older resolution monitors will be phased out and the majority of people will have newer monitors capable of higher resolution. In the future, the small amount of people that still have old computers with small monitors will be forced to either upgrade or constantly scroll. Websites in general have advanced tremendously over the last ten years. If someone has an older computer, they will have difficulty viewing the websites of today and scrolling for a long time will be the least of their worries. In terms of mobile devices, a program similar to the iPhone will become necessary. Hopefully in the future all mobile devices capable of viewing the internet will have a similar program so the internet is in its true form. This will allow users to see the pages they wish to view but not need to worry about scrolling forever. I think that if websites were larger we would be able to include more content and include more interesting material. This would open doors for websites and allow designers to have more space to work with. Even though the new bigger websites will include more or have a better spaced out setup, they will still be just as easy to navigate. I definitely see this as a possibility for the future.
